In the following sentence, a part of the sentence is underlined. Below are given alternatives to the underlined part, which may improve the sentence. Choose the correct alternative. In case no improvement is needed, choose the alternative that indicates 'No improvement.' Both Ria as well as Nishant are going to the same college for further studies. Correct Answer And
The correct option would be 3 i.e.' and' because ‘both’ and ‘as well as’ can not be used together.
Hence, the correct statement would be 'Both Ria and Nishant are going to the same college for further studies.'
